Elsa Erazor III Extreme Review
June 11, 1999   Tim Hsu > [View My Other Articles]
Product Info | User Reviews | Article Images(4) | Image Gallery | Comments | Forum Thread
ERAZOR III Specs

The ERAZOR III comes with 32MB of SEC (Samsung) 7ns SDRAM, arranged in 4 chips that are 8MB each. The card layout is very similar in appearance to the reference nVidia TNT2 layout.

The ERAZOR III has a heatsink on the TNT2 chip, but no fan. Even then, it didn't heat up too much in normal or gaming operation. At default voltage, it was barely lukewarm. Overclocking made it slightly warmer, but nothing too bad. Our lab's ambient temperature is pretty cool, however.

TwiN-Texel (TNT) 32-bit graphics pipeline
32MB 7ns Samsung SDRAM
300 MHz RAMDAC
100% hardware triangle setup
16 and 32-bit ARGB rendering (RGB plus alpha)
Single pass multi-texturing support, square and non-square texture support
Point-sampled, bilinear, trilinear, and 8-tap anisotropic filtering
Per pixel perspective correct texture mapping: fog, light, MIP mapping
24-bit Z-buffer, 8-bit stencil buffer
Full scene anti-aliasing
AGP texturing
128-bit 2D pipeline, optimized for 8, 16, 32-bit color depths
Support for textures up to 2048x2048 (2K x 2K)
Maximum 2D/3D resolution of 1920x1440
AGP 4x/2x/1x support, with sideband support
Bump mapping (emboss), light maps, reflection and environmental maps
ELSA 3D REVELATOR stereoscopic 3D glasses
Brooktree TV-Out
Video outs: 1 S-video, 1 composite
Video ins: 1 S-video, 2 composites
ELSA VideoControl "digital VCR"
ELSA MainActor V3 video editing tool
ELSAMovie software DVD player

We've also heard that the card is going to come with a CD sampler that has some 20 games on it, but didn't get that CD with our kit.
